Riding a noisy motorcycle in downtown Chicago will soon become a very expensive proposition.

A new ordinance passed by the City Council last week will slap a fine of up to $500 on a motorcyclist who removes his muffler and revs his motor in the Loop.

The current fine tops out at $100.

A local motorcycle advocacy group says it sees nothing wrong with imposing noise limits on cyclists.
